5 Essential Steps for Prepping for Power Outages

Hello ladies,
My name is Jade Tripp, and I’m here to talk to you about the importance of being prepared for power outages. Power outages can happen at any time, whether it’s due to a storm, a blackout, or some other unforeseen event. Being prepared for a power outage can help keep you and your loved ones safe and comfortable during these challenging times.
Here are five essential steps for prepping for power outages:
1. Create an Emergency Kit: One of the first things you should do to prepare for a power outage is to create an emergency kit. This kit should include items such as flashlights, batteries, a first aid kit, non-perishable food, water, and any necessary medications. Having these essential items on hand can help you stay safe and comfortable during a power outage.
2. Stay Informed: It’s important to stay informed about the status of the power outage and any updates from local authorities. Make sure you have a battery-powered or hand-cranked radio to stay connected to the latest information. Knowing what’s going on can help you make informed decisions about your safety and well-being.
3. Safeguard Your Home: Take steps to safeguard your home and belongings in case of a power outage. This may include unplugging sensitive electronics, securing outdoor furniture and objects, and ensuring your home is properly insulated to maintain a comfortable temperature during the outage. By taking these precautions, you can minimize the potential damage to your property.
4. Have a Communication Plan: It’s essential to have a communication plan in place in case of a power outage. Make sure you have a way to contact family members, friends, and neighbors in case of an emergency. Consider designating a meeting place or out-of-town contact to coordinate communication and ensure everyone’s safety.

How Personal Alarm Systems Can Save Lives in Emergency Situations

Hello ladies,
Today I want to talk to you about the importance of personal alarm systems in emergency situations and how they can truly be lifesaving tools in times of need.
First and foremost, personal alarm systems are a great way to alert others of your location and situation in case of an emergency. Whether you are out for a run in the park or walking home late at night, having a personal alarm on hand can provide you with a sense of security and peace of mind knowing that help is just a push of a button away.
One real-life example of the effectiveness of personal alarm systems is the case of Sarah Johnson, a young woman who was walking home from work one night when she was suddenly approached by a stranger. Feeling threatened, Sarah activated her personal alarm, which emitted a loud siren that immediately caught the attention of passersby. The would-be attacker was scared off and Sarah was able to safely make her way home thanks to the quick response of those nearby.
Another benefit of personal alarm systems is their ability to deter potential attackers. Many predators look for easy targets, and the sound of a loud alarm going off can often be enough to make them think twice about approaching you. Just having a personal alarm visible on your keychain or in your purse can serve as a powerful deterrent and make you less likely to be targeted by criminals.
Personal alarm systems are also useful in situations where you may not be able to scream for help, such as if you are injured or physically restrained. In these instances, a personal alarm can be a literal lifesaver, providing a way for you to signal for help even when you are unable to speak or move.
